Organizational Behaviour

Section A – 2 Marks Each


1. What is meant by personality?

Ans :- Personality means how a person thinks, feels, and acts. It makes everyone different.

2. What is motivation?

Ans :- Motivation is the push inside us to do something. It makes us work.

3. What do you understand by teamwork?

Ans :- Teamwork means people working together to do a job.

4. Write one difference between Type A and Type B personality.

Ans :- Type A people work fast and get angry quickly. Type B people are calm and do not hurry.

5. What is a leader?

Ans :- A leader is someone who guides others and helps them do their work.

6. What are values?

Ans :- Values are things we believe are right or wrong. Like honesty and kindness.

7. Write the meaning of organizational behaviour.

Ans :-It means how people act and work together in an office or company.

Section B – 5 Marks Each

1. Maslow’s Need Pyramid ?


Ans :-

Maslow said people have 5 types of needs:

Food and Water – We need to eat and sleep.


Safety – We want to feel safe and have a job or home.
Love – We want friends and family.
Respect – We want to feel proud and be respected.
Growth – We want to learn and do what makes us happy.

2 . Big Personality Traits ?


Ans :-

Openness – Likes new ideas and learning.


Conscientiousness – Works carefully and does not forget things.
Extraversion – Likes talking and being with people.
Agreeableness – Is kind and friendly.
Neuroticism – Gets worried or sad easily.

3. What is emotional intelligence? Why is it important at work?

Ans :-
It means knowing your feelings and others’ feelings.

It helps you stay calm, talk nicely, and work better with people.

4. Things That Make a Good Leader ?

Ans :-

Talks clearly
Listens to the team
Helps everyone
Makes good choices
Is fair and kind

5. Herzberg’s Two-Factor Theory


Ans :- There are 2 types of things at work:

Motivators – Make people happy like praise or learning.


Hygiene factors – Do not make people happy, but if missing, they feel bad (like low
pay or bad rules).

6. What is a team? Why is it good?

Ans :-
A team is a group of people who work together.

Teams are good because:

People help each other.


Work is finished faster.
It feels nice to work with others.

7. Difference between Democratic and Autocratic Leader ?

Ans :-
Democratic Leader – Listens to others and works with the team.
Autocratic Leader – Gives orders and wants only their way.

8. What Affects a Person at Work?

Ans :-
Problems at home
A kind or strict boss
Work pressure
Friends or fights at work
Health and mood

9. What is Organizational Change? Types?

Ans :-

Organizational change means when a company changes something big.

Types ; -
Small Change – Like giving training.
Big Change – Like changing all teams or rules.

10. Future of Work with AI and Automation

Ans :-

Robots and computers will do easy jobs.


People will need to learn new skills.
New jobs will come.
People and machines will work together.

11. Theory X and Theory Y

Ans :-

Theory X – Thinks people are lazy and don’t want to work.


Theory Y – Thinks people like to work if they are trusted.

12. What is Perception? Example?

Ans :-
Perception means how you see or understand something.

Example: You think your teacher is nice, but someone else may think she is strict.
13. What are Team Norms? Why are They Useful?

Ans :-

Team norms are team rules.

They help people work together nicely, talk kindly, and finish work on time.

Section C – 20 Marks Each

Q 1. Motivation – Full Topic

1 :- What is Motivation?
Ans :-

Motivation means the energy or push inside us to do something.

It makes us want to work, study, or reach our goals.

2 Maslow’s Theory (Needs Pyramid)

Maslow said people have 5 levels of needs. We try to finish the lower needs first, then go
up.
1. Basic Needs – Food, water, sleep.
2. Safety Needs – House, job, no danger.
3. Love and Belonging – Family, friends, feeling loved.
4. Respect (Esteem) – Feeling proud, others like you.
5. Growth (Self-fulfilment) – Doing what makes you happy, like your dream job.

3 Herzberg’s Theory
There are two types of things at work:

Motivators – These make people happy and work better (like learning new things,
getting praise, doing good work).
Hygiene Factors – These do not make people happy, but if they are missing, people
feel bad (like no salary, bad rules, or no break time).

4 Why Motivation is Needed at Work


People work harder and better.
They feel happy and stay longer.
There is less fighting and fewer complaints.
Work gets done faster.
Workers enjoy their job more.

Q 2. Leadership and Teamwork in the Office

1 What is Leadership?
Ans :- Leadership means guiding others.

A leader shows the way, helps the team, and makes decisions.

2 Different Types of Leader


Ans :-

1. Autocratic Leader – Gives orders and wants things their way.


2. Democratic Leader – Listens to the team and works with them.
3. Charismatic Leader – Inspires others with their strong personality.
4. Creative Leader – Brings new ideas and helps people think differently.
5. Transformational Leader – Brings big changes and teaches others to grow.

3 Qualities of a Good Leader


Ans:-

Listens to others
Helps the team
Makes good choices
Is honest and fair
Talks nicely and clearly

4 What is Teamwork?
Ans :-

Ans :- Teamwork means people working together to finish a task.

In offices, teams do work faster and better when they help each other.

5 Roles in a Team
Ans :-

Leader – Guides everyone


Helper – Supports the team
Note-taker – Writes down ideas
Problem Solver – Fixes problems
Encourager – Keeps the team happy and motivated

6 How Leaders Help Teams


Ans :-

They share work clearly.


Solve problems and fights.
Cheer up the team when they are tired.
Help team members do their best.
Make sure everyone follows the rules.
